From 2f562699ea936f9639ccf5deef2e7b458a7426bf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: =?UTF-8?q?Ludovic=20Court=C3=A8s?= Date: Mon, 22 Jun 2020 16:40:18 +0200 Subject: doc: cookbook: Mention "guix hash -rx" for Git checkouts. * doc/guix-cookbook.texi (Extended example): Mention "guix hash -rx ." --- doc/guix-cookbook.texi | 18 ++++++++++++++++++ 1 file changed, 18 insertions(+) (limited to 'doc') diff --git a/doc/guix-cookbook.texi b/doc/guix-cookbook.texi index 31c4cd4121..efafbd9d93 100644 --- a/doc/guix-cookbook.texi +++ b/doc/guix-cookbook.texi @@ -852,6 +852,24 @@ version when packaging programs for a specific commit, following the Guix contributor guidelines (@pxref{Version Numbers,,, guix, GNU Guix Reference Manual}). +How does one obtain the @code{sha256} hash that's in there, you ask? By +invoking @command{guix hash} on a checkout of the desired commit, along +the lines: + +@example +git clone https://github.com/libgit2/libgit2/ +cd libgit2 +git checkout v0.26.6 +guix hash -rx . +@end example + +@command{guix hash -rx} computes a SHA256 hash over the whole directory, +excluding the @file{.git} sub-directory (@pxref{Invoking guix hash,,, +guix, GNU Guix Reference Manual}). + +In the future, @command{guix download} will hopefully be able to do +these steps for you, just like it does for regular downloads. + @subsubsection Snippets Snippets are quoted (i.e. non-evaluated) Scheme code that are a means of patching -- cgit v1.2.3
